You'll need:
- Your proposed company name
- At least one eligible director (18+, with at least one ordinarily resident in Australia), with confirmation that each proposed director has applied for a director ID before appointment
- At least one shareholder
- A registered office address and principal place of business in Australia
- Your share structure
- Signed director and member consents
- The occupier's consent if the registered office is not occupied by the company
Our online form guides you through each step.
A Pty Ltd company is a separate legal entity; a sole trader and the business are the same legal person. Limited liability is not absolute: directors and shareholders can still face exposure for personal guarantees, unpaid share capital, director-duty or insolvent-trading breaches and some tax debts. A qualifying base-rate entity may pay 25% company tax; otherwise the company rate is 30%. Companies also have additional setup, reporting and ongoing compliance obligations.
A company generally needs its own TFN and will usually obtain an ABN if it carries on an enterprise. GST and PAYG registrations depend on its turnover, activities and circumstances. These registrations are separate from ASIC company registration.
